Hurricane Beryl’s Wake: Devastation from the Caribbean to the U.S., Urgent Aid Needed as Communities Struggle with Power Loss and Disease Risk

Hurricane Beryl, marking its strength as the strongest Atlantic hurricane to hit in early July, has left a swath of destruction across the Caribbean, Yucatan Peninsula, and the United saids, leaving in its wake a trail of extensive damage to infrastructure and persistent power failures. As the storm tore through regions last week, it wreaked havoc, causing multiple deaths and about $6.4 million in damage to crops and infrastructure in Jamaica alone.

In the storm’s aftermath, approximately 300,000 businesses and homes across Texas are still without electricity amid soaring temperatures and stifling humidity. Communities heavily affected by income disparities are particularly struggling, facing exacerbated risks of heat-related illnesses and increasing insecurity regarding food and water supplies.

Jamaica has seen widespread impact across all its regions, with severe consequences for public health facilities. The Rocky Point Hospital in Clarendon Parish is currently non-operational, and neighboring facilities are grappling with disruptions to their water and power supplies. Saint Elizabeth’s health clinics have sustained significant damage, forcing relocation of services which burden already taxed resources in these makeshift facilities.

The International Medical Corps is actively coordinating with the Jamaican Ministry of Health to expedite the procurement of critical supplies and to ensure the provision of necessary resources and training at impacted healthcare facilities. Efforts are underway to address the heightened risk of water- and vector-borne diseases such as dengue and leptospirosis, which are a result of the prevailing flood waters and standing pools.

In Texas, the situation remains dire as low-income households find themselves at an elevated risk. Power outages and subsequent heat waves have rendered many individuals, particularly the elderly, children, and those with chronic conditions or reliant on battery-powered medical devices, extremely vulnerable. Compounded by insufficient air conditioning, inadequate water supplies, and the challenges of food and medication preservation, these households are experiencing severe distress.

President Joe Biden responded to the crisis by amending the Disaster Declaration for Texas on July 12, authorizing federal assistance to aid the impacted communities. Many individuals in economically challenged communities, often situated in ‘food deserts’ with limited access to grocery stores, have resorted to purchasing supplies from convenience stores and gas stations. With electric refrigeration compromised, the lack of proper food storage has led to increased food wastage, further complicating the food insecurity crisis.

Healthcare workers in these communities report not only material damage but also mental health strains as they deal with both the storm’s aftermath and ongoing health emergencies in inadequately equipped facilities.
